motherboard size isn't just about
0:26
physical dimensions it dictates what
0:28
your system can handle in terms of ports
0:30
expansion slots cooling and overall
0:33
potential so how do you choose atx
0:37
boards are the largest of the trio and
0:39
the go-to for gamers and power users
0:42
with ample space for multiple graphics
0:44
cards extra RAM slots and plenty of
0:47
ports ATX offers the most versatility
0:49
and upgrade potential it's perfect for
0:52
full-size PC cases where air flow and
0:54
performance are top priorities
0:57
microatx sits comfortably in the middle
1:00
it trims down the size without
1:02
sacrificing too much functionality
1:04
you still get decent expandability
1:07
usually toopsy slots and four RAM slots
1:09
but in a more compact format for users
1:12
who want a capable system without going
1:14
all out MicroATX is often the sweet spot
1:18
then there's MiniITX the minimalist
1:21
Marvel it's the smallest standard size
1:24
designed for compact builds and
1:25
space-saving setups with just one C slot
1:29
and two RAM slots it's not made for
1:31
heavy expansion but shines in
1:33
portability and sleek designs ideal for
1:36
HTPCs land party builds or clean
1:39
desktops that need to do more with less
1:42
each size comes with trade-offs atx
1:45
gives you room to grow but requires a
1:47
larger case miniitx saves space but
1:50
limits upgrade paths microatx finds the
1:54
balance but only if that balance suits
1:56
your needs so before diving into your
1:59
build ask yourself do you value
2:01
space-saving elegance balanced
2:03
practicality or full-scale customization
2:06
knowing your answer will guide you
2:08
toward the right motherboard size and
2:10
the right build for your lifestyle
